Gerd Steffens is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Oncology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Gerd Steffens has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Cancer Research and 6 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Gerd Steffens’s work include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(10 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(6 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(6 papers). Gerd Steffens is often cited by papers focused on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(10 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(6 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(6 papers). Gerd Steffens collaborates with scholars based in Germany, The Netherlands and Belgium. Gerd Steffens's co-authors include John B. Buse, Leopold Flohé, Fritz Ötting, Wolfgang A. Günzler and Johannes Schneider and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, FEBS Letters and Infection and Immunity.
